Word vs. LaTeX: The Clear Choice for Academia
A Comparison of Document Creation Systems for Academic and Scientific Publishing
For serious academic and scientific publishing, LaTeX stands out as the superior choice. Below is a structured comparison of Microsoft Word and LaTeX across key features important to researchers and scholars.
| Feature | Microsoft Word | LaTeX |
|---|---|---|
| 1. Document Structure | Relies on manual formatting Requires frequent reformatting Formatting inconsistencies are common | Logical document structure defined by code Automatic formatting throughout the document Consistent layout and structure |
| 2. Mathematical Equations | Basic equation editor Difficult to handle complex mathematical expressions Formatting inconsistencies in advanced equations | Professional mathematical typesetting Ideal for complex equations and scientific notation Consistent and publication-ready formatting |
| 3. Bibliography Management | Manual reference formatting Prone to citation errors Difficult to update references globally | Automated referencing with BibTeX or BibLaTeX Perfectly formatted citations Easy updating and maintenance |
| 4. Long-Term Stability | Proprietary file format Version compatibility issues | Open-standard format Backward compatible Long-term accessibility guaranteed |
| 5. Journal Compliance | Requires manual formatting adjustments Time-consuming formatting corrections Higher risk of submission errors | Pre-built journal templates Automated formatting compliance Submission-ready documents |
| 6. Collaboration | Track Changes feature only Formatting conflicts during collaboration Difficult to merge multiple revisions | Version control integration (e.g., Git) Clear change tracking Easy merging of contributions |
| 7. Professional Output | Basic printing quality Formatting inconsistencies Less visually refined output | Professional typesetting High-quality, consistent output Industry standard for academic publishing |
| 8. Learning Curve | Easy to learn Widely used | Initial learning curve Becomes intuitive with practice Extremely powerful once mastered |
